4. Technical Parameters
Model BXC-2t BXC-20t BXC-50t BXC-100t BXC-150t
Rated Load(t) 2 20 50 100 150
Table Size (mm) Length(L) 2000 4000 5500 6500 10000
Width(W) 1500 2200 2500 2800 3000
Height(H) 450 550 650 900 1200
Wheel Base(mm) 1200 2800 4200 4900 7000
Rail Inner Gauge(mm) 1200 1435 1435 200 2000
Wheel Diameter (mm) 270 350 500 600 600
Running Speed (m/min) 0-25 0-20 0-20 0-20 0-18
Motor Power(kw) 1 2.2 5 10 15
Battery Capacity 180 180 330 440 600
Battery Voltage 24 48 48 72 72
Running Time When Full Load 4.32 4 3.3 3.2 2.9
Running Distance for One Charge(km) 6.5 4.8 4 3.8 3.2
Recommended Rail Model P15 P24 P43 QU100 QU100

7. Q&A
Will A Transfer Cart Be A Good Solution?
A good question to ask since there are many material handling solutions on the market! Which one is the right choice? For starters, transfer carts are moveable platforms used for the horizontal movement of materials, assemblies, and other items. Consideration must be given to the weight of the load and the travel requirements for the application.
What Are The Advantages of Using a Transfer Cart?
For smaller loads, manual carts can be dedicated to specific work place activities such as shuttling materials. This often makes the carts more available for use. Transfer carts are more accommodating for moving long loads through restrictive passage ways or doorways. For heavier loads transfer carts are an excellent affordable choice for their ability to handle heavy loads. Transfer carts are compact in design and work well in areas with limited floor area. Another advantage over lift trucks is how the cart deck can be customized to suit specific loads.
What Product Handling Applications Use Transfer Carts?
1.   Coils (V-Groove deck)
2.   Tanks (size/stability for uniformly distributed loads)
3.   Assemblies (fixture cradle) for a complete build or to send a partially completed product to the next station (tractors, heavy equipment machinery)
4.   Sub-Assembly shuttle from one line to another line
5.   Maintenance cart for motors and pumps
6.   Equipment support (stand-off deck) for navigating loads to locations with a plant facility
7.   Material shuttle for steel tubing (flat decking with guard rails)
8.   Elevating platform for assembly process (integrated screw-jack table)
9.   Sand casting (flat decking)
What Types of Transfer Carts Are There?
There are three types of transfer carts, each designed for different applications. They are:
Towed Type Carts - For loads up to 150 ton. Carts have casters or crane wheels and are manually moved on smooth to semi-smooth floors or are towed behind lift trucks or behind powered carts mounted on rail. They are an economical alternative to purchasing a second powered cart. Winches can also be used to pull carts of this type for on-rail applications. Carts can be sized according to requirements of work areas with space constraints.
On-Rail Type Carts - For loads up to 500 ton. Carts are mounted on steel rail for shuttling along a fixed path. They can be AC powered or DC battery powered. Typically used for moving materials such as steel or tanks of liquids from one location to another. Larger cart capacities and sizes are available for specific applications. Custom deck frames can be designed for specific assemblies to carry an entire shift of production and even serve as a stable moveable machine base.
Steerable Type Carts - For loads up to 120 ton. Carts have two fixed and two swivel casters and are DC battery powered (optional AC powered). Carts are designed to travel on smooth to semi-smooth level floors. Customization is available for specific applications.
What Surfaces Do Transfer Carts Travel On?
The On-rail Transfer Cart is designed with flanged wheels and travels on rail. Most applications are on level surfaces; however, it is possible for carts to travel on inclines not greater than 4°. 
With steerable carts flat tread steel wheels (hardened tread surface) come standard and are fine for most concrete smooth to semi smooth floors. For non-marking epoxy floor systems, optional urethane wheels can be ordered (up to 20 ton capacity). Carts are not designed for uneven surfaces such as gravel, rough terrain, or badly cracked concrete floors.
How fast can carts travel?
Typically, carts come with drive motor speed of 50 mpm (with brake). Optional consideration can be given to ordering VFD (electric car only) for soft start/stop movement. Faster travel speeds can be ordered.
How are carts powered?
Powered AC carts have power cable connected directly to an electrical panel, typically for carts that travel along a fixed path. Cable reels can be installed for cable management.
Powered DC carts have on-board batteries that have an average running time of 16 hours. DC battery charging units can be installed on-board for convenience. Extended battery life can be accomplished by having four batteries rather than two.
